A gargantuan Bitcoin whale has been spotted moving over a billion dollars in BTC in a series of transactions that effectively emptied a number of newly created cryptocurrency wallets.
Data from Blockchain.com as first reported by Daily Hodl, the Bitcoin bag holder drained a crypto wallet that was initially holding over 74,105 BTC worth more than $1.58 billion.

At first, the crypto whale moved the whopping BTC in two transactions. The first transaction involved the movement of 50,562 BTC to an unknown wallet. While the second transaction moved a total of 23,542 BTC to a separate wallet of unknown origin.
Afterward, the investor relocated the previous 50,562 BTC to the same wallet that received 23,542 BTC.
The anonymous crypto whale did not stop there. He later transferred the massive Bitcoin trove in a series of large transactions into separate wallets.
The total number of the shifted Bitcoin is slightly higher than the BTC that was initially transferred, suggesting that the entity behind the transactions may have mixed in a few BTC in the process.
At the time of filing this report, Bitcoin is trading at $21,310, with a relatively 2% price upsurge in the last 24 hours.
